Data Integration এবং Form Automation Techniques

Microsoft Technologies - মাইক্রোসফট শেয়ারপয়েন্ট (Sharepoint) - SharePoint Forms এবং Power Apps Integration
266

SharePoint ব্যবহারের ক্ষেত্রে Data Integration এবং Form Automation অত্যন্ত গুরুত্বপূর্ণ ফিচার। এই দুটি প্রক্রিয়া মূলত ডেটা সংগ্রহ, প্রসেসিং এবং রিপোর্টিংকে সহজ করে তোলে, যা আপনাকে ডেটাবেস, অ্যাপ্লিকেশন, এবং ফর্ম প্রক্রিয়া অটোমেট করতে সহায়তা করে। নিচে এই দুটি গুরুত্বপূর্ণ টপিকের বিস্তারিত আলোচনা করা হলো।


Data Integration in SharePoint

Data Integration হল একাধিক উৎস থেকে ডেটা সংগ্রহ এবং তা একটি সেন্ট্রালাইজড প্ল্যাটফর্মে একত্রিত করা। SharePoint-এ ডেটা ইন্টিগ্রেশন এর মাধ্যমে আপনি বিভিন্ন সোর্স (যেমন, SQL Server, Excel, Web Services) থেকে ডেটা নিয়ে আসতে পারেন এবং SharePoint সাইটে প্রদর্শন করতে পারেন।

স্টেপ ১: SharePoint Lists এবং Libraries ইন্টিগ্রেট করা

  • SharePoint Lists এবং Document Libraries থেকে ডেটা ইন্টিগ্রেট করতে পারেন। এটি সাধারণত External Data ব্যবহার করে করা হয়, যার মাধ্যমে আপনি SharePoint থেকে বাইরের ডেটাবেস বা সার্ভিসের সাথে কানেক্ট করতে পারবেন।
  • External Content Types (ECTs) তৈরি করে আপনি বাহ্যিক ডেটা উত্স (যেমন, SQL Server, Web Services) SharePoint এর সাথে ইন্টিগ্রেট করতে পারেন।
    • SharePoint Designer বা PowerApps ব্যবহার করে আপনি External Data Lists তৈরি করতে পারবেন।

স্টেপ ২: Excel এবং SharePoint ইন্টিগ্রেশন

  • Excel ফাইলকে SharePoint Document Library তে আপলোড করে আপনি সেটি শেয়ার এবং কোলাবরেটিভভাবে ব্যবহার করতে পারেন।
  • Excel ডেটা Power Query ব্যবহার করে SharePoint List-এ ইন্টিগ্রেট করা সম্ভব। এতে Excel-এর ডেটা SharePoint Lists এবং Document Libraries-এ আপডেট হয়।

স্টেপ ৩: Web Services Integration

  • SharePoint ওয়েব সার্ভিসের মাধ্যমে অন্য কোনো অ্যাপ্লিকেশন বা সিস্টেমের ডেটার সাথে ইন্টিগ্রেট করা সম্ভব। আপনি REST API বা SOAP Web Services ব্যবহার করে বাইরের ডেটা সিস্টেমের সাথে কানেক্ট করতে পারেন।
  • BCS (Business Connectivity Services) ব্যবহার করে বাইরের ডেটাবেসে সংযোগ স্থাপন করে, সেই ডেটাকে SharePoint Lists বা Libraries-এ প্রদর্শন করা সম্ভব।

স্টেপ ৪: Power Automate (Flow) ব্যবহার করে ডেটা ইন্টিগ্রেশন

  • Power Automate (পূর্বে Microsoft Flow) ব্যবহার করে ডেটা ইন্টিগ্রেশন অটোমেট করা যায়। উদাহরণস্বরূপ, একটি ডেটাবেসে পরিবর্তন হলে, সেই ডেটা SharePoint List-এ স্বয়ংক্রিয়ভাবে আপডেট হয়ে যাবে।
  • Power Automate দিয়ে আপনি বিভিন্ন অ্যাপ্লিকেশন এবং সার্ভিসের মধ্যে ডেটা ট্রান্সফার করতে পারেন। উদাহরণস্বরূপ, SQL Server, Dynamics 365, SharePoint, OneDrive এবং অন্যান্য সিস্টেমের মধ্যে ডেটা সিঙ্ক্রোনাইজ করতে পারবেন।

Form Automation Techniques in SharePoint

Form Automation SharePoint এর মাধ্যমে বিভিন্ন ফর্ম সংক্রান্ত কাজ যেমন তথ্য সংগ্রহ, ডেটা সাবমিশন এবং প্রসেসিং অটোমেট করা। SharePoint এর Form Automation একাধিক ফর্ম তৈরির জন্য ব্যবহৃত হয়, যা একটি ওয়েব ইন্টারফেসের মাধ্যমে ব্যবহারকারীদের ইনপুট নেওয়া এবং প্রক্রিয়া করা সম্ভব করে।

স্টেপ ১: SharePoint Lists ব্যবহার করে ফর্ম তৈরি

  • SharePoint Lists মূলত ডেটা সংগ্রহের জন্য একটি সাধারণ ফর্ম হিসেবে কাজ করে। আপনি Custom Forms তৈরি করতে পারেন যা SharePoint Lists থেকে ডেটা সংগ্রহ এবং প্রদর্শন করবে।
    • New Item Form: একটি SharePoint List এর জন্য স্বয়ংক্রিয়ভাবে একটি ফর্ম তৈরি হয়। এই ফর্মটি ব্যবহারকারীকে তালিকা আইটেম তৈরি বা আপডেট করতে সাহায্য করে।
    • Custom Forms: আপনি PowerApps ব্যবহার করে SharePoint List এর জন্য কাস্টম ফর্ম ডিজাইন করতে পারেন।

স্টেপ ২: PowerApps ব্যবহার করে কাস্টম ফর্ম তৈরি

  • PowerApps SharePoint Lists এর জন্য কাস্টম ফর্ম তৈরি করতে ব্যবহার করা হয়। আপনি Canvas App বা Model-driven App ব্যবহার করে অত্যন্ত কাস্টমাইজড এবং ইন্টারেক্টিভ ফর্ম তৈরি করতে পারবেন।
  • PowerApps এর মাধ্যমে আপনি ফর্মের লেআউট, ভ্যালিডেশন, এবং ফাংশনালিটি কাস্টমাইজ করতে পারবেন, যাতে ডেটা ইনপুট আরও সহজ এবং কার্যকর হয়।

স্টেপ ৩: Microsoft Forms এর মাধ্যমে ডেটা সংগ্রহ

  • Microsoft Forms এর মাধ্যমে ফর্ম তৈরি করে SharePoint Lists বা Libraries-এ ডেটা জমা করা সম্ভব। Microsoft Forms দিয়ে আপনি কাস্টম ফর্ম তৈরি করতে পারেন এবং সেগুলোকে Power Automate এর মাধ্যমে SharePoint List-এ স্বয়ংক্রিয়ভাবে পাঠাতে পারেন।

স্টেপ ৪: Power Automate এর মাধ্যমে ফর্ম প্রক্রিয়া অটোমেশন

  • Power Automate ব্যবহার করে আপনি ফর্ম প্রক্রিয়াকে সম্পূর্ণ অটোমেট করতে পারবেন। উদাহরণস্বরূপ:
    • একটি ফর্ম সাবমিট করার পর, সেই ডেটা SharePoint List বা ডাটাবেসে সেভ হয়ে যাবে।
    • ফর্ম সাবমিশনের পর ইমেইল নোটিফিকেশন বা অ্যাপ্রুভাল প্রক্রিয়া অটোমেট করা যাবে।
  • Approval Workflows: ফর্মে পাঠানো ডেটার অনুমোদন নিতে আপনি Approval Workflows সেট আপ করতে পারেন।

স্টেপ ৫: Nintex Workflow বা SharePoint Designer Workflow

  • Nintex Workflow অথবা SharePoint Designer Workflow ব্যবহার করে SharePoint সাইটে ফর্ম প্রক্রিয়াগুলোর জন্য অটোমেটেড ওয়ার্কফ্লো তৈরি করা যায়।
    • এগুলোর মাধ্যমে আপনি ফর্ম সাবমিট হওয়ার পর ডেটা প্রসেসিং, ইমেইল পাঠানো, অথবা অন্য কোনো প্রক্রিয়া অটোমেট করতে পারেন।

উপসংহার

Data Integration এবং Form Automation SharePoint এর জন্য অত্যন্ত গুরুত্বপূর্ণ দুটি ফিচার, যা ব্যবহারের মাধ্যমে ডেটা সংগ্রহ এবং প্রসেসিং সহজতর করা যায়। Power Automate, PowerApps, এবং External Data Connections এর মাধ্যমে আপনি SharePoint কে আরও কার্যকরী এবং সিঙ্ক্রোনাইজড করতে পারবেন। Form Automation এর মাধ্যমে ফর্ম প্রক্রিয়া অটোমেট করা সম্ভব, যা কাস্টম ফর্ম তৈরি এবং ডেটা সংগ্রহ প্রক্রিয়াকে আরো সহজ এবং দ্রুত করে তোলে।

Content added By
Promotion
NEW SATT AI এখন আপনাকে সাহায্য করতে পারে।

Are you sure to start over?

Loading...